Selecting a color palette might seem overwhelming with the myriad of options available. Before diving into specific shades, consider the atmosphere you want to create. Warm tones, such as reds, yellows, and oranges, evoke energy and coziness, making them perfect for communal areas like living rooms and kitchens. Meanwhile, cool tones like blues, greens, and purples promote relaxation and tranquility, ideal for bedrooms and bathrooms. Understanding this fundamental color psychology can guide your choices and help align the mood of your space with your personal or professional intentions.
Another crucial step in choosing a color palette is assessing the natural light in the room. Rooms with ample sunlight can handle bolder, darker colors, which can add drama and depth. Conversely, spaces with limited natural light may benefit from lighter hues that reflect the available light, making them feel larger and more airy. Consider the existing elements within your space that might influence your color decisions. Furniture, flooring, and architectural elements like fireplaces and trim provide cues on complementary shades that work harmoniously together. If you have a favorite piece of art or a patterned area rug, pick out colors from these items to use as accents throughout the room, creating a cohesive and visually pleasing environment.
An effective color palette often includes a balance of base colors and accents. A classic approach is the 60-30-10 rule: 60% of a dominant color, 30% of a secondary color, and 10% for an accent color. This ratio helps in maintaining balance and interest without overwhelming the senses. The dominant color typically covers walls, while the secondary color appears in furniture or upholstery, and the accent color is featured in smaller accessories like pillows, artwork, or decorative pieces.
